The Importance of Regular Publishing
Publishing blog posts on a regular schedule helps keep your audience engaged. When readers know they can expect new content, they are more likely to return to your site. This builds trust and loyalty over time.
Benefits of Consistent Blogging
- Improved SEO: Regularly updated content signals to search engines that your site is active. This can help improve your rankings.
- Audience Growth: Consistency attracts new visitors. When you publish regularly, you increase the chances of being discovered by new readers who find your content valuable.
- Streamlined Marketing: A set publishing schedule allows you to plan your marketing efforts more effectively. You can coordinate social media posts, email newsletters, and other promotional activities around your blog schedule.
Automating Your Publishing Process
For small to mid-size service businesses, finding the time to write, edit, and publish can be a challenge. Automation tools can simplify this process. Here are a few ways automation can help:
- Content Creation: Use tools that help generate topics or even write drafts based on your guidelines.
- Scheduling: Set up your posts to publish automatically at designated times. This saves you from having to remember to do it manually.
- Promotion: Automate social media sharing to promote your new posts as soon as they go live.
